Core Duties and Responsibilities
Each position carries specific responsibilities that contribute to the overall success of the project. Safety Officers are responsible for monitoring work activities, conducting inspections, enforcing safety regulations, and ensuring compliance with HSE requirements. Work Permit Receivers coordinate and manage permit systems, verify work authorization, and ensure that all activities are conducted safely. Fire Watchers continuously monitor hot work areas, identify fire hazards, and respond quickly to potential emergency situations. Document Controllers organize, maintain, and manage project records, ensuring that all documentation is accurate, updated, and readily accessible when required by project teams and management.
Required Skills, Knowledge, and Qualifications
Applicants should possess strong professional skills relevant to their respective positions. Safety Officers should have knowledge of occupational health and safety procedures, risk assessment techniques, and site safety regulations. WPR candidates should understand permit-to-work systems and industrial operational requirements. Fire Watchers must demonstrate alertness, hazard awareness, and emergency response knowledge. Document Controllers should have excellent organizational skills, document management experience, computer proficiency, and attention to detail. Previous industrial project experience is considered an advantage for all categories, while good communication skills and a commitment to workplace safety are highly valued.
